Beam Therapeutics has outlined its strategic priorities for 2026, focusing on its genetic disease and hematology franchises. The company has reached an agreement with the FDA on an accelerated approval pathway for BEAM-302, targeting Alpha-1 Antitrypsin Deficiency, and plans to submit a Biologics License Application for risto-cel by the end of 2026. With an estimated $1.25 billion in cash, Beam aims to extend its operating runway into 2029, supporting the anticipated launch of risto-cel and the development of BEAM-302. The company is also expanding its liver-targeted genetic disease programs and expects to announce new initiatives in 2026.
